Slab Square Tarur 4 is a bold, normal width, medium contrast, italic, tall x-height font visually similar to 'ARB 93 Steel Moderne' by The Fontry (names referenced only for comparison).

A compact, oblique slab-serif with squared terminals and chunky, rectangular serifs that read as integrated blocks rather than delicate finishing strokes. The forms are strongly geometric with rounded-rectangle counters, clipped corners, and a consistent forward slant that gives the design a fast, directional rhythm. Stroke joins are crisp and mechanical, with subtle cut-ins and notches that add a stenciled, engineered character. Numerals and capitals share a robust, uniform presence, while lowercase maintains a high, sturdy silhouette suited to tight setting.

Well suited to sports and motorsport-style branding, event posters, punchy headlines, and tech-forward packaging where a sense of speed and impact is desired. It also fits game titles and interface accents that need a compact, forceful voice without resorting to overly decorative styling.

The overall tone is energetic and performance-oriented, mixing a retro athletics flavor with a clean, machine-made edge. Its slanted stance and blocky serifs communicate momentum, confidence, and a slightly rugged utilitarian attitude.

The font appears designed to deliver a high-impact display voice by combining an oblique stance with heavy, squared slabs and engineered detailing. Its constructed geometry and dense rhythm suggest an intention to evoke speed, durability, and a contemporary-industrial sensibility.

The design relies on strong horizontals and squared-off features that stay legible at display sizes, with distinctive inner shapes (especially in bowls and the squared ‘O’/‘0’ feel) that reinforce the technical, constructed look. Spacing appears designed for impactful headline lines, producing a dense, punchy texture when set in paragraphs.
